Web13 apr. 2024 · Lynx are classified as medium-sized members of the cat family. The smallest species of lynx is the bobcat and the Canada lynx and the largest is the Eurasian lynx. Lynx are characterized as having short tails, large, padded paws, long facial whiskers, and tufts of black hair on the tips of their ears. They range in color from medium brown to a ... Web9 aug. 2024 · Five species are listed as Endangered on the IUCN Red List of Threatened species: tiger, Borneo bay cat, Andean cat, flat-headed cat and Iberian lynx. Thirteen more wild cat species are listed as Vulnerable: lion, leopard, snow leopard, clouded leopard, Sunda clouded leopard, African golden cat, northern oncilla, southern oncilla, guina ... Lynx cats prefer cold, wilderness … Web25 apr. 2024 · A lynx refers to any one of the four species belonging to the genus Lynx. These animals are medium-sized wild cats that live in parts of North America and Eurasia. There are four species of lynx, the Canadian lynx, Eurasian lynx, bobcat, and the Iberian lynx. WebSome areas of Scotland and England could successfully support a lynx population. There has been increased discussion on this topic in recent years, including the 2024 – 22 Lynx to Scotland consultation. If a viable reintroduction project was proposed, it would likely have the support of many conservation organisations including Rewilding Britain. A bobcat’s tail is striped with black bands towards the end and has a black tip. prusaslicer extra length on restartThe Eurasian lynx inhabits rugged country providing plenty of hideouts and stalking opportunities. Depending on the locality, this may include rocky-steppe, mixed forest-steppe, boreal forest, and montane forest ecosystems. In the more mountainous parts of its range, Eurasian lynx descends to the lowlands in winter, following prey species and avoiding deep snow.
